Introduction to the Impact of AI on Job Markets
The advent of Artificial Intelligence (AI) is rapidly transforming job markets across the globe, presenting both opportunities and challenges. Companies like Amazon are finding themselves at the forefront of this revolution. As detailed in various industry reports, AI's capability to perform complex tasks with accuracy and efficiency is becoming increasingly attractive, prompting businesses to integrate these technologies more deeply into their operations. However, this shift also raises questions about the future landscape of employment and the roles that humans will continue to play. Amazon's recent statements highlight this dual-edged impact as they explore how AI can streamline operations all while hinting at potential job reductions.
In recent developments, companies like Microsoft have announced significant layoffs, partly due to the advancements and integration of AI. These moves are indicative of a broader trend where technology not only replaces certain job functions but also necessitates new skill sets that current employees may not possess. According to Goldman Sachs, there is a likelihood that around 25% of jobs could be automated by generative AI, signaling a profound shift towards an AI-centric job economy. This aligns with insights from tech leaders who argue that while AI will eliminate certain jobs, it will also create new ones, particularly in tech-driven industries.

The potential for AI to cause widespread job displacement is a subject that has cultural and economic implications. The Challenger, Gray & Christmas report reflects that the introduction of AI and other tech updates were responsible for 20,000 layoffs in the first half of 2025 alone in the tech sector. Such statistics underscore the urgent need for effective retraining programs and policy frameworks that address these seismic job market changes.

Current Trends in AI-Induced Layoffs
In today's rapidly evolving technological landscape, the intersection of artificial intelligence (AI) and employment dynamics is prompting significant discourse, particularly concerning AI-induced layoffs. Companies like Amazon and Microsoft are reportedly at the forefront of integrating AI technologies, which is leading to structural changes within their workforce. For instance, Microsoft is planning substantial layoffs, majorly impacting its sales teams, as it simultaneously boosts investments in AI. This juxtaposition underscores a broader trend among tech giants where AI's potential for efficiency gains is resulting in job cuts [see source](https://finance.yahoo.com/news/amazon-ceo-andy-jassy-says-company-will-cut-jobs-amid-ai-boom-its-already-happening-at-microsoft-213847151.html).
The predictions by major financial institutions and consulting firms further illustrate the potential scale of AI-induced workforce transformations. Goldman Sachs, for example, suggests that generative AI could automate approximately 25% of jobs across various sectors. This prediction is reflective of the transformative power of AI and interlinks with data from the Challenger, Gray & Christmas report, which quantifies the layoff impacts in the tech sector due to technologies like AI [see source](https://finance.yahoo.com/news/amazon-ceo-andy-jassy-says-company-will-cut-jobs-amid-ai-boom-its-already-happening-at-microsoft-213847151.html).

Expert Opinions on Website Accessibility
Website accessibility has been a growing focus among experts, especially regarding its impact on inclusivity and user experience. The A11Y Collective points out that JavaScript implementation, when not done correctly, can create significant barriers for those who rely on screen readers or keyboard navigation. By ensuring the use of device-independent event handlers and ARIA attributes, websites can improve compatibility and accessibility, fostering a more inclusive online environment .

Strategies for Mitigating AI's Impact on Jobs
As AI technology continues to integrate into various sectors, strategic approaches are necessary to mitigate its impact on job displacement. One effective strategy is the emphasis on reskilling and upskilling initiatives. This involves providing current workers with training in skills that are aligned with emerging technologies. By fostering a workforce that is adaptable to the technological landscape, companies can ensure their employees are more versatile and less susceptible to redundancy. According to a report by Challenger, Gray & Christmas, about 20,000 tech jobs were lost in early 2025 due to technological transformations, including AI integration [source]. Developing training programs targeted at these displaced workers could mitigate the socioeconomic impacts of AI-induced job loss.
Creating a supportive social safety net is another crucial strategy to handle AI’s impact on employment. Strengthening unemployment benefits and investing in reemployment services can protect workers during transitions between jobs. Countries with robust safety nets and training programs often experience smoother workforce transitions when disruptive technologies, like AI, are introduced [source]. Moreover, political and legislative efforts could focus on incentivizing companies to provide in-house retraining or job rotation opportunities, which would allow employees to develop in areas less affected by automation.
